Safety Features<br />

A number of safety features are incorporated onto the AS3691. Over<br />

temperature protection is built in that switches off the <strong>LED</strong> current<br />

when the die temperature reaches 140 degrees C. On the AS3691A, the<br />

<strong>LED</strong> current never falls to zero, always maintaining 5% of the maximum<br />

current through the <strong>LED</strong>s. This is to keep the <strong>LED</strong>s conducting so there<br />

is always a voltage drop across them in order to keep the voltage seen<br />

by the CURR pins within specification. If it is desired to have the <strong>LED</strong><br />

current decreasing to less than 100uA, the AS3691B has this feature.<br />

The AS3691 provides a small, low cost solution for driving small or large<br />

<strong>LED</strong> networks – and it guarantees by design that the exact colour is<br />

achieved within the whole system. Because it regulates the current and<br />

the voltage on the low side, it can control both low and high voltage<br />

systems and does not limit the designer to a particular <strong>LED</strong> architecture.<br />

It is suitable for small RGB lighting applications, backlighting large<br />

<strong>LED</strong> displays, automotive dashboard illumination and architectural<br />

lighting.<br />
